Single professional development subjects (units)/current student electives
- GBL subjects may be taken for professional development purposes or on a cross-institutional basis.
- La Trobe Graduate-Entry LLB students may be permitted to take GBL subjects as law electives from the end of first year onwards. Undergraduate Entry LLB students in single or double degree programs may access GBL subjects from third year onwards. In all cases, admission to the GBL electives is subject to application and quota and will be at the discretion of the program co-ordinator. Students will be charged per subjects at their current course fee rate.
